Abstract
A diterpenoid, neostellerin, was isolated from the roots of Stellera chamaejasme L together with4 known compounds identified as β-sitosterol, scopoletin, umbelliferone and daucosterol. The structure ofneostellerin, which was elucidated by NMR, especially 2D NMR analysis, was different from other daphnane typediterpenes isolated from this plant.
